The ambient temp gauge on these cars always displays the temp in Celsius, its german, thats just how it is. There's no way to "set" it to Farenheit.
If you don't want to do a conversion, then just figure out what C temps are comfortable, or look some up and remember some ranges: -20C= REAL cold -10C= Pretty cold 0C = Cold 10C = Cool but nice (also is exactly 50F) 20C = Warm 25C = Very Warm 30C = Hot 50C = Your tires are now melted onto the pavement 500C = You've made a wrong turn and are in a volcano....

Or...
0 = 32 5 = 41 10 = 50 15 = 59 20 = 68 25 = 77 30 = 86 35 = 95 40 = 104 Every 5 deg C = 9 deg F. You can also take the C reading and multply by 2 and then subtract 10% of that and add it to 32. For example, 17 deg C = (17 * 2) - (17 * 2)*.1 + 32 Or 34 - 3.4 = 30.6, add 32 and the final answer is 62.6 deg F
